The eerie lullaby (part 1)

Julie was a mischievous girl, always stirring up trouble wherever. People whispered behind her back, calling hr a little troublemaker- and she seemed to wear the title like a little badge of honor. She loved exploring places she wasn't supposed to, sneaking into empty rooms, and testing the limits of what she could get away with. Her curiosity often got her into sticky situations, but Julie didn't mind. To her every scolding glance and whispered warning was just another part of the adventure.

But there was one place in the village that even Julie hesitated to go: the forest near her house. Dark and tangled, it looked like a shadow at the edge of everything similar. She had heard countless stories about children disappearing there in the dead of night, vanishing without a trace. The villagers spoke of strange noises - rustling leaves sounded like whispers, tall trees and shadows moved when no one was there. Though Julie was brave - perhaps curious - her little heart always pounded when she heard the stories and thought of venturing too far into its depths.

One night, Julie lay awake in her bed, unable to fall asleep. For some reason, she sat up and gazed into the window. The forest looked darker and more alive than ever, its twisted casting long, claw like shadows across the ground. Despite the fear curling in her stomach, curiosity bubbled inside her. What if... She went into the forest?

She wondered what if she ignored the warning of the elders. Then, almost as if the forest itself was calling her, a faint whispering voice drifted on the wind, singing a haunting lullaby:

"Come, little children.... Come to play"

Julie slipped out of her bed and grabbed a lantern. Quietly, opened the door and stepped into the night. The lanterns glow trembled across the path, barely pushing back the darkness. A cold wind sliced through the trees, carrying the scent of damp leaves. Every step made her heart pound faster. The distant howls of wolves echoed through the forest, blending with rustling leaves and soft sighs of unseen creatures. Her hand shook as she clutched the lantern, but still something drew her forward.

Suddenly, the eerie lullaby grew louder, closer, weaving itself around her mind. Julie felt her legs move on its own, carrying her deeper into the forest. Cold and expressionless, she walked, and her small feet finally stopped in front of an abandoned mansion. It's windows were dark and cracked and the air around it felt heavier.

Julie snapped back to her senses and froze. In front of her, a swing moved gently on its own. Swaying in the windless night. No one was around, yet the air seemed thick with invisible eyes. Something was watching her. She spun around, heart hammering, but the forest and the mansion were empty. Panic surged through her. She tried to run... But her feet wouldn't move, as if invisible hands had gipped her, holding her in place.
